Crash Trends and Traffic Risks in Virginia

Virginia’s diverse geography means crash risks vary widely across the state. Urban centers such as Richmond, Virginia Beach, and Arlington often report high numbers of multi-vehicle crashes and pedestrian incidents due to dense traffic. In rural areas, single-vehicle collisions and rollovers are more common, particularly on two-lane highways.

Interstates play a central role in the state’s crash statistics. I-95, I-64, I-81, and I-66 are some of the busiest corridors, carrying commuters, freight traffic, and travelers along the East Coast. These routes frequently see congestion-related crashes and serious collisions involving large trucks.

Counties such as Fairfax, Prince William, Henrico, and Chesterfield consistently rank among those with the highest traffic accident reports in Virginia.

Weather also contributes to roadway dangers. Heavy rainfall, icy conditions in the Blue Ridge Mountains, and fog along the Shenandoah Valley increase crash risks throughout the year. Tourist destinations such as Virginia Beach and the historic corridor near Williamsburg also experience seasonal traffic surges, which add to congestion and accident frequency.

Requesting a Virginia Police Accident Report

Obtaining an official Virginia police accident report is one of the most important steps after being involved in a crash. These reports provide essential details, including information on the drivers and vehicles, roadway and weather conditions, and any citations issued. Insurance companies rely on this documentation to process claims, and attorneys use it to assess the facts of a case.

Having a police report ensures the incident is accurately recorded. It helps reduce disputes with insurers, protects your rights, and provides a foundation for seeking compensation when necessary.
